This is the final report of a one-year Laboratory Directed Research and Development (LDRD) project at Los Alamos National Laboratory (LANL). The People`s Republic of China will be moving toward considerably increased use of motorized vehicles over the next human generation. Estimates are for a fleet of 100 million vehicles or more. Large increases in ozone and other types of pollution associated with automobiles will result and this will have significant impact across Asia and into the Pacific. In this project the authors have taken a continental scale approach in a two-dimensional photochemical model to estimate the ozone concentrations to be expected. Potential levels of nitrate/soot in aerosols and increase in carbon dioxide are also discussed. Major pollution problems are forecast for the Pacific Rim if Chinese projections for their automotive sector are realized. |
